Position: Nurse Practitioner (NP) / Physician Assistant (PA)

The Advanced Practice Provider (APP) — Nurse Practitioner (NP) or Physician Assistant (PA) — provides primary medical care within a federally contracted ICE residential facility.

The APP conducts medical evaluations, diagnoses and treats acute and chronic conditions, prescribes medications, orders and interprets diagnostic testing, manages infectious disease concerns, responds to medical emergencies, and coordinates referrals for higher levels of care. This role works collaboratively with physicians, nursing staff, behavioral health professionals, pharmacy personnel, and other interdisciplinary team members to ensure safe, effective, and culturally responsive healthcare services.

This position requires experience caring for pediatric and adult populations, sound clinical judgment, and the ability to perform effectively in a fast-paced environment.
